Leadership and Management at Soft2Bet: How Direction Shapes Growth

Date:

Running an international technology company like Soft2Bet is, before anything else, a management problem: keeping decisions fast, teams aligned and strategy consistent as the business grows. Founded in 2016, Soft2Bet has become an international iGaming business in under a decade, operating across 22 licences in 12 jurisdictions as both a B2B platform provider and a B2C operator.

Holding an operation that large together, with many brands, markets and functions running at once, depends less on any single product than on the decisions that keep them all moving in the same direction. 

Principles of Modern Leadership at Soft2Bet

Soft2Bet is shaped less by its formal structure than by the principles behind its everyday decisions. Two of them carry the most weight, and their interaction explains much of its recent performance.

The first concerns decision-making speed. As player expectations, technologies, and market conditions continue to evolve, companies often seek organisational structures that allow teams to respond efficiently and make decisions within their areas of responsibility. A product team can test a feature without escalating it; a market team can act on local signals without waiting on a central function. The choice is intentional and reflects a focus on enabling teams to respond efficiently to changing product and market requirements.

The second concerns how performance is measured. Soft2Bet’s leadership attributes the company’s growth to disciplined execution and places emphasis on output, efficiency, and measurable outcomes.

Managing International Teams

As Soft2Bet has grown, the harder management problem has become coordination – keeping teams across product, engineering, marketing, operations and compliance working toward the same goals in multiple markets and time zones. The company approaches this on two fronts:

  1. Coordinating the work. Teams are organised around clear ownership, so that responsibility for a brand, a market or a part of the platform belongs to the people closest to it. That keeps accountability clear and removes the delays that build up when every decision has to clear a single point.
  2. Building effective communication. A distributed, multinational organisation only works when information moves cleanly between its parts. The objective is to ensure the exchange of information between different teams and disciplines, so that knowledge and experience gained in one area can be shared across the company.
